Trying to fix broken wire – solder not melting
Can anyone tell me what temperature is needed to melt the solder that holds the wires for the battery. We had a wire break off and I thought it would be straight forward to re-solder it back in place but my SparkFun 937b soldering iron is not melting the solder on the board. I'm fairly certain the iron is working as it easily melts the solder I'm planning to use to reattach the wire.
-
Problem solved. A tip from a co-worker was to melt some solder onto the original solder ball that was not melting. What do you know, it all melted and the solder wick pulled it all away. within a few minutes I had a clean hole to connect the power line. I am now back to operational and uploaded version 1.4.0
